Good things to know

Which word is more common?

Acceptance is more commonly used than consent in everyday language. Acceptance is versatile and covers a wide range of contexts, while consent is more specific and often used in legal or medical contexts.

What’s the difference in the tone of formality between acceptance and consent?

Consent is typically associated with a formal or legal tone, while acceptance can be used in both formal and informal contexts.
